Taekwondo, painting and science don’t seem like complementary endeavors.
But they are for Vrushali Patel, a Discovery Canyon High School senior who finds inspiration and purpose in the intricacies of each.
“I pay attention to details and form brush strokes, competitive kicks, clarifying experiments.”
She was first attracted to painting as a child in India, where every Sunday she rode her bike to art class. “I drew pictures of my dad working on his laptop or flowers in our garden.”
Recently her brush strokes helped feed the hungry. Her paintings were auctioned at a fundraiser where her father works. The proceeds benefited Care and Share.
